agenta

The open-source LLMOps platform: prompt playground, prompt management, LLM evaluation, and LLM observability all in one place.

Visit WebsiteView on GitHub
4.0k
Stars
+332
Stars/month
10
Releases (6m)

Overview

Agenta 是一个开源的 LLMOps 平台,为大语言模型应用开发提供端到端的解决方案。该平台将提示词操场、提示词管理、LLM 评估和可观测性功能整合在一个统一的界面中,帮助开发者更快速地构建可靠的 LLM 应用。作为开源项目,Agenta 采用 MIT 许可证,为开发者提供了灵活的使用和定制权利。平台既提供自托管版本,也有云服务选项,满足不同规模团队的需求。通过集成的工作流,开发者可以在同一平台上进行提示词实验、管理版本、评估模型性能,并监控生产环境中的应用表现。这种一体化的方法显著简化了 LLM 应用的开发和运维流程,减少了在多个工具间切换的复杂性。

Pros

  • + 集成化平台设计,将提示词管理、评估和监控功能统一在一个界面中,简化工作流
  • + 开源且采用 MIT 许可证,提供了透明度和灵活的定制能力
  • + 同时提供自托管和云服务选项,适应不同的部署需求和安全要求

Cons

  • - 相对较新的项目,社区生态和文档可能不如成熟的商业产品完善
  • - 需要一定的技术背景进行部署和配置,对非技术用户可能存在门槛
  • - 作为开源项目,企业级支持可能有限,主要依赖社区维护

Use Cases

Getting Started

1. 通过 pip 安装 agenta 包或从 GitHub 克隆源代码进行本地部署;2. 启动平台服务并通过 Web 界面创建新项目;3. 导入现有 LLM 应用或创建新的提示词模板开始第一次评估实验